shopify二次開發(fā)的意義是什么?
shopify作為越來越流行的電商平臺,今天給大家?guī)淼氖莝hopify二次開發(fā)的意義。
shopify二次開發(fā)的意義第一個是充分利用原有系統(tǒng)功能,把工作量降低到最小。
本文就來介紹shopify二次開發(fā)的意義是什么?一、如果做二次開發(fā)的,需要是在平臺原有的一些基礎功能上升級,這就要求不能破壞原有的功能邏輯,又要利用好先有的功能,因為要實現某些功能的時候,可能有的功能已經有了。
例如,電商平臺需要做一個充值的功能,平臺原本就有支付功能,禮券功能,那我們就可以考慮把兩個功能綜合起來進行改造。
二次開發(fā)的意義第二個是站在平臺角度上設計、開發(fā),做到模塊化、工具化。
二次開發(fā)系統(tǒng)的時候,需要跳出來考慮,開發(fā)的視角,不局限于項目本身,不局限于項目組本身,要站在全局的角度考慮。
例如,有這樣一個場景,負責退換貨業(yè)務的項目組,需要開發(fā)一個功能,退款成功后需要推送一條消息給APP客戶端,這個時候,可能需要研究一下第三方解決方案,然后調用第三方API開發(fā)相應的功能。
無獨有偶,支付組,可能也要做類似的功能,在用戶支付成功后,需要推送一條消息給app,提醒一下用戶支付成功了,這個時候,支付組又要研究一下第三方推送的解決方案,做重復性工作了。
其實一開始,退換貨組就應該分析到,消息推送應該是比較通用的功能,完全可以開發(fā)一個通用的工具模塊、工具,給整個公司的人使用。
系統(tǒng)穩(wěn)定之后,還需要做效果評估,看開發(fā)的功能、做的項目是否帶來了回報 ,效果如何,看有沒有什么地方需要改進、升級,獲取更大的回報。
以上就是兩點給大家?guī)韘hopify二次開發(fā)的意義。
本文內容根據網絡資料整理,出于傳遞更多信息之目的,不代表金鑰匙跨境贊同其觀點和立場。
轉載請注明,如有侵權,聯(lián)系刪除。